Hoof
English Meaning
The horny substance or case that covers or terminates the feet of certain animals, as horses, oxen, etc.
- The horny sheath covering the toes or lower part of the foot of a mammal of the orders Perissodactyla and Artiodactyla, such as a horse, ox, or deer.
- The foot of such an animal, especially a horse.
- Slang The human foot.
- To trample with the hoofs.
- Slang To dance, especially as a professional.
- Slang To go on foot; walk.
- hoof it Slang To walk.
- hoof it Slang To dance.
- on the hoof Not yet butchered; alive. Used especially of cattle.
